# Provenance: taxgrid-cache builds

Quick note for support: the taxgrid-cache service (the thing that caches regional tax-rate lookups for Hollowmart checkout) ships from the Brightquay pipeline, fully pinned — no snowflake builds. If a customer reports a stale rate, first check which build their region is running before escalating. Rates refresh hourly, so most complaints resolve themselves. The current production build is listed right below.

pipeline stamp: htk4_ae36

Sharding the Plumeria profile store is mostly boring, but account recovery gets weird mid-migration. If a user's profile is split across shards, the recovery flow will 404 until the backfill catches up. Don't panic — run the reconcile script on shard-7 first, it's always the laggard. If the recovery console itself refuses your session, you'll need to re-auth with the break-glass passphrase, which is below.

recovery phrase for bawep-kawef: oliath-casdor

Discussed the Flourline bakery order-cutoff rule. Current behavior: orders lock at 14:00 local store time; the Pattenridge store runs a pilot with a 15:30 cutoff. Decision: keep cutoff enforcement in the backend `cutoff` module only; front-end countdowns are display-only. New team members should not add per-store exceptions in config — use the pilot flag mechanism instead. Open item: timezone handling for the coastal stores, ticket filed. Final authority on cutoff changes and pilot approvals rests with the person named below.

account owner for kafop-haweg: Pelax Gilael Istir